Instantaneous Acceleration

Let's discuss a problem useful for Physics Olympiad based on Instantaneous Acceleration. The Problem: Velocity-displacement curve of a particle moving in a straight line is as shown 2m/s2 5 m/s2 1 m/s2 Zero Discussion: Acceleration a=v dv/ds From, the graph, we can see a=vtanθ tanθ=1/4 Putting the values, we get acceleration a= 1m/s2

Understanding the Infinitesimal

Understanding the Infinitesimal  Cheenta Notes in Mathematics   Let's discuss a beautiful idea related to progress in mathematics and understanding the infinitesimal. Adding infinitely many positive quantities, you may end up having something finite. Greeks did not understand this very well. Archimedes had some ideas.
